😐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,316 in Bucharest versus $950 in Piatra Neamt.
😐Estimated couple costs with rent: $2,132 in Bucharest versus $1,471 in Piatra Neamt.
😐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$2,949 in Bucharest versus $1,992 in Piatra Neamt.
🌍Living in Bucharest is roughly 39% more expensive than in Piatra Neamt,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.
📊Both cities sit below the global median: Bucharest1% lower, Piatra Neamt29% lower.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$661 in Bucharest and $351 in Piatra Neamt.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.
💰Bucharest pays 4%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.
🛒Dining out: $69.0 in Bucharest vs $36.00 in Piatra Neamt for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$235 vs $194 per month, with Piatra Neamt cheaper across the board.
